これらの中で、グリニヤール試薬は一般に反応性が低く、反応の基質としてアリールクロリドまたはアリールブロミドを用いる反応では反応可能な基質が限定され、また反応を完結させるためには過剰量の使用や、長い反応時間を必要とするなどの問題がある(非特許文献3参照)。また、反応の基質としてアリールヨージドに対しては反応性が高いが、原料へのヨード基の導入は高価であり、工業的には好ましくない。
しかしながら、上記のハロゲン−金属交換反応で得られる化合物は、医薬品、農薬、液晶、電子写真や染料等の分野で合成中間体として有用性が高い。一例を挙げると、2−ブロモピリジンを原料として合成される2−リチオピリジンは、ファルマコアとして有用である2,4−ビピリジン誘導体の合成中間体である。この2,4−ビピリジン誘導体は、例えばtetrabenazine antagonist(非特許文献6参照)、α1A receptor antagonist(特許文献2参照)、5−HT1A receptor antagonist(特許文献3参照)、α1A receptor antagonist(特許文献4参照)等の合成中間体に用いられている。

本発明の製造プロセスを簡潔に説明すると、ハロゲン化合物と有機リチウム試薬を、少なくとも1個の連続式反応器で混合し、前記一般式(I)で表されるリチウム化合物を得る。次いで、このリチウム化合物と求電子化合物とを反応させて目的物を得る。

定常マイクロ反応器とは、小型流動反応器、または静的マイクロミキサー(スタティックマイクロミキサー)を使用して定常状態で反応を実施するための反応装置である。静的マイクロミキサーとは、例えばWO96/30113号に記載されているような、混合のための微細な流路を有しているミキサーに代表される装置である。市販されている定常マイクロ反応器としては、例えばインスティチュート・フュール・マイクロテクニック・マインツ(IMM)社製シングルミキサーおよびキャタピラーミキサー;ミクログラス社製ミクログラスリアクター;CPCシステムス社製サイトス;山武社製YM−1型ミキサー;島津GLC社製ミキシングティーおよびティー;マイクロ化学技研社製IMTチップリアクター、等が挙げられ、いずれも本発明で使用することができる。
インラインミキサーは、ラインミキサーやパイプラインミキサーとも呼ばれており、連続した流れの中で複数の液体を攪拌混合する装置であり、複数の液体の混合比率を正確に制御することができるという特長を有し、スタティックミキサーやプロペラ式ミキサー、タービン式ミキサー、ローター/ステーター式ミキサー、コロイドミル、高圧ホモジナイザーのようなものが含まれる。市販されているインラインミキサーとしては、例えば、東レ製Hi−Mixer;ケニックス社製スタティックミキサー;特殊機化工業製パイプラインホモミキサー;西華産業製OHRラインミキサー等が挙げられ、いずれも本発明で使用することができる。
本発明において、好ましくは定常マイクロ反応器である。定常マイクロ反応器を用いることにより、原料溶液の迅速な混合や流れの制御、および反応熱の部分蓄熱の防止や反応温度の精密な制御が可能となる。合成反応を定常状態で安定して実施できるため、安定化した合成プロセスが実現される。
連続式反応器に送液される際の流速は、反応する基質、連続式反応器の種類、および連続式反応器の流路断面積によって最適値は異なるが、例えば定常マイクロ反応器の場合は、好ましくは0.1μl/分〜1000ml/分、より好ましくは1μl/分〜100ml/分、特に好ましくは10μl/分〜10ml/分である。

本発明で用いるハロゲン化合物は、塩素化合物、臭素化合物、ヨウ素化合物等が挙げられるが、その中でも臭素化合物、ヨウ素化合物が反応性が高く好ましい。
n−ブチルリチウムを用いた3−ブロモアニソールのハロゲン−リチウム交換反応をインスティチュート・フュール・マイクロテクニック・マインツ(IMM)社製シングルミキサー(流路断面積12,000μm2、ニッケル オン カッパー インレイ)を用いた定常マイクロ反応器内で行った。このシングルミキサーは分割された流路から得られる多数の副流を接触させることにより混合を行う方式のものであり、定常マイクロ反応器の出口には外径Φ1.58mm、内径Φ0.8mmのSUS316製キャピラリーをHPLCコネクターを用いて接続し、キャピラリーの出口は一方にドレン流路の付いた三方バルブを介し、クロロトリメチルシランのテトラヒドロフラン溶液を入れてあるアルゴンガス置換済みの100ml二口フラスコに導いた。また定常反応器とSUSキャピラリー、二口フラスコの温度は恒温冷却水槽の冷媒中で0℃に温度設定した。

アルゴンガスで置換した100ml二口フラスコにn−ブチルリチウム7mlとテトラヒドロフラン35mlを仕込み、ドライアイスーアセトン浴に浸して−78℃に冷却した。、攪拌下、3−ブロモアニソール1.72gを滴下して−78℃で30分間攪拌した。次に、この中にクロロトリメチルシラン1.5gとテトラヒドロフラン9mlの混合溶液を滴下して−78℃で20分間攪拌した後、徐々に室温まで30分間かけて昇温した。得られた反応液を定量分析した結果、目的物の収率は90%だった。
アルゴンガスで置換した100ml二口フラスコに3−ブロモアニソール1.72gとテトラヒドロフラン35mlを仕込み、ドライアイスーアセトン浴に浸して−78℃に冷却した。この中に攪拌下、n−ブチルリチウム7mlを滴下して−78℃で30分間攪拌した。次に、この中にクロロトリメチルシラン1.5gとテトラヒドロフラン9mlの混合溶液を滴下して−78℃で20分間攪拌した後、徐々に室温まで30分間かけて昇温した。得られた反応液を定量分析した結果、目的物の収率は88%だった。

すなわち、バッチプロセスでは−78℃もの超低温冷却が必要な反応が、本発明の製造方法である、マイクロ流路を用いた定常反応器を反応に使用してフロー系で実施する方法を使用することで、超低温冷却を必要とせず、0℃という温和な冷却条件で有機リチウム試薬を用いたハロゲン−リチウム交換反応を実施できる。本製造方法はベンゼン誘導体のみならず、ナフタレン誘導体や、ピリジン誘導体の様な複素環化合物にも適用可能であり、有用性が高い。
